示例(命令行): Linux/macOS:export GOOGLE_APPLICATION_CREDENTIALS="/path/to/your/key.json" Windows: Skybox AI 一键将涂鸦转为360°无缝环境贴图的AI神器 52 查看详情 $env:GOOGLE_APPLICATION_CREDENTIALS="/path/to/your/key.json" 同样,将 /path/to/your/key.json 替换为实际的 JSON 文件路径。
如果这些复杂逻辑散落在代码的各个角落,维护起来会非常困难。
文章将指导读者理解HDF5数据结构,识别扁平化图像数据,并提供多种策略(包括检查数据集属性、查找伴随数据集及使用HDFView工具)来获取关键的图像维度信息。
在CakePHP 4框架中,处理文件上传时,经常需要在验证规则中检查文件的MIME类型。
这背后有一个重要的设计考量:避免因拼写错误导致的隐蔽问题。
在循环外部定义的变量在整个循环过程中都保持其状态,而在循环内部定义的变量则在每次迭代时重新创建或初始化。
以下是常见的实现方法。
本文旨在提供一种使用Python从复杂URL中准确提取图像文件扩展名的方法。
掌握fmt的基本用法,能帮助我们更高效地打印日志、调试程序和处理字符串。
而且,频繁地在每个new操作周围放置try-catch块会使代码变得臃肿且难以维护。
许多开发者在使用go test时,可能会遇到测试函数未被执行或测试意外通过的问题。
4. 尝试访问并判断(不推荐单独使用) 使用 operator[] 会自动插入键(如果不存在),这可能改变 map 内容,因此不适合仅做存在性检查。
在C++中,自定义类的拷贝构造函数和赋值运算符是为了控制对象的复制行为。
以Python为例,使用xml.etree.ElementTree模块: 从根节点开始,层级设为0 每进入一层子节点,层级加1 打印或存储每个节点的标签及其对应层级 示例代码片段: import xml.etree.ElementTree as ET <p>def print_node_level(element, level=0): print(f"{' ' * level}{element.tag} (Level {level})") for child in element: print_node_level(child, level + 1)</p><p>tree = ET.parse('example.xml') root = tree.getroot() print_node_level(root)</p>利用XPath估算节点层级 XPath本身不直接提供“层级”函数,但可以通过路径表达式间接判断节点深度。
关键在于理解 reflect.Value 和 reflect.Type 的使用方式。
form 属性的工作原理 定义表单: 首先,在符合HTML规范的位置定义一个<form>元素,并为其指定一个唯一的id。
比如将驼峰命名转为下划线小写: $camel = "userNameProfile"; $snake = preg_replace_callback( '/([a-z])([A-Z])/', function ($matches) { return $matches[1] . '_' . strtolower($matches[2]); }, $camel ); echo $snake; // 输出:user_name_profile 正则捕获小写字母后紧跟大写字母的位置,插入下划线并转小写,实现风格统一。
数组的引用 数组引用是指给一个固定大小的数组类型起个别名,避免退化为指针。
因此,添加 if len(list_of_variables) >= rand_index_var: 这样的检查是多余的,因为这种情况永远不会发生。
Linux(Ubuntu/Debian):运行 sudo apt update && sudo apt install ffmpeg Linux(CentOS/RHEL):使用 yum install ffmpeg 或 dnf install ffmpeg Windows:从官网下载FFmpeg,解压后将路径添加到系统环境变量PATH中 安装完成后,在命令行输入 ffmpeg -version 验证是否安装成功。
本文链接:http://www.asphillseesit.com/379428_322b88.html